Turner & Townsend appoints new Africa MD following Profica acquisition
Global professional services company Turner & Townsend has completed its strategic acquisition of Profica, a Johannesburg-headquartered consultancy specialising in real estate project management and construction solutions across Africa.
Following the acquisition, former Profica CEO and founder Tim White has been appointed regional MD for Africa at Turner & Townsend, effective from April.
Having co-founded Profica in 2005 and built the business’ strong presence across sub-Saharan Africa, Turner & Townsend notes that White has extensive experience in the management and delivery of large, high-profile and complex projects in the property, construction and civil engineering industries, across the region.
The company says the completed acquisition creates Africa's leading real estate project management consultancy, combining two highly complementary businesses with a team of nearly 400 dedicated professionals with deep market insight.
It also expands Turner & Townsend’s presence in Africa from 13 cities in 11 countries to 19 cities in 16 countries, reinforcing its commitment to long-term investment and growth in the region.
Turner & Townsend says White will play a key role in integrating the businesses and driving future growth across the continent.
Moreover, the partnership means Turner & Townsend can now provide a full asset lifecycle offering in Africa, with expanded capabilities in development management, principal contracting and construction management.
Key growth areas include data centres, hotels, principal contracting delivery and development consulting services.
The company explains that Profica has deep regional expertise and a strong client portfolio, having managed the delivery of successful real estate projects across Africa for 21 years across key sectors.
Notable recent projects include the Stanbic IBTC head office, in Nigeria; the Netcare Alberton Regional Trauma Hospital, in South Africa; the Mövenpick Hotel Kigali, in Rwanda; and Maersk’s three new flagship warehouses, in Senegal and South Africa.
“This partnership brings together two of Africa's largest project management companies and I'm excited to lead our combined team as we unlock greater opportunities for our clients.
“Our unique combination of scale, reach and capability, with unparalleled market knowledge across the continent, places us in a prime position to deliver solutions based on real experience, data and local insight, to help solve the industry's biggest challenges in Africa,” says White.
Turner & Townsend has operated in Africa for over 40 years and has more than 3 000 projects either completed or ongoing across the region.
The company says the combined business is now the largest and most experienced built environment professional services company in Africa with established offices and teams based in all major regions, including English-, French- and Portuguese-speaking countries.
